diff --git a/recipes/spades/3.11.1/meta.yaml b/recipes/spades/3.11.1/meta.yaml index 78667670300ec..d196842926d15 100644 --- a/recipes/spades/3.11.1/meta.yaml +++ b/recipes/spades/3.11.1/meta.yaml @@ -11,7 +11,7 @@ source: sha256: 3ab85d86bf7d595bd8adf11c971f5d258bbbd2574b7c1703b16d6639a725b474 # [linux] build: - number: 2 + number: 3 requirements: build: diff --git a/recipes/spades/3.12.0/build.sh b/recipes/spades/3.12.0/build.sh new file mode 100644 index 0000000000000..528c0d0ecc04c --- /dev/null +++ b/recipes/spades/3.12.0/build.sh @@ -0,0 +1,12 @@ +#!/bin/bash + +set -e -o pipefail + +outdir=$PREFIX/share/$PKG_NAME-$PKG_VERSION-$PKG_BUILDNUM +mkdir -p $outdir +mkdir -p $PREFIX/bin + +cp -r bin $outdir +cp -r share $outdir + +ln -s $outdir/bin/* $PREFIX/bin diff --git a/recipes/spades/3.12.0/meta.yaml b/recipes/spades/3.12.0/meta.yaml new file mode 100644 index 0000000000000..8392711adb22b --- /dev/null +++ b/recipes/spades/3.12.0/meta.yaml @@ -0,0 +1,49 @@ +{% set version = "3.12.0" %} + +package: + name: spades + version: {{ version }} + +source: + # We currently cannot build SPAdes from source, because it requires g++ 5.3.1 or later, + # which bioconda does not yet support. Therefore, we fetch the statically compiled binaries. + url: https://github.com/ablab/spades/releases/download/v{{ version }}/SPAdes-{{ version }}-Darwin.tar.gz # [osx] + sha256: e2a4f589c190767310545300386c7e2841ebdfe3775850cd52879ef01d376575 # [osx] + url: https://github.com/ablab/spades/releases/download/v{{ version }}/SPAdes-{{ version }}-Linux.tar.gz # [linux] + sha256: 5e8988b0cfd8b5a84b718e1e5af21524c7b1369bcba337dfebeed9c22a4f7141 # [linux] + +build: + number: 1 + +requirements: + run: + - python + +test: + commands: + - spades.py --version + - rnaspades.py --version + - truspades.py --version + - dipspades.py --version + - metaspades.py --version + - plasmidspades.py --version + - spades.py --test && rm -rf spades_test + - spades-kmercount -h + +about: + home: http://cab.spbu.ru/software/spades/ + license: GPLv2 + license_family: GPL + license_file: share/spades/LICENSE + summary: | + SPAdes (St. Petersburg genome assembler) is intended for both standard isolates and single-cell MDA bacteria assemblies. + dev_url: https://github.com/ablab/spades + doc_url: http://cab.spbu.ru/files/release{{version}}/manual.html +extra: + recipe-maintainers: + - druvus + - notestaff + identifiers: + - biotools:Spades + - doi:10.1089/cmb.2012.0021 + - doi:10.1101/gr.213959.116 diff --git a/recipes/spades/meta.yaml b/recipes/spades/meta.yaml index 8392711adb22b..bc4459e9048c9 100644 --- a/recipes/spades/meta.yaml +++ b/recipes/spades/meta.yaml @@ -1,4 +1,4 @@ -{% set version = "3.12.0" %} +{% set version = "3.13.0" %} package: name: spades @@ -8,12 +8,12 @@ source: # We currently cannot build SPAdes from source, because it requires g++ 5.3.1 or later, # which bioconda does not yet support. Therefore, we fetch the statically compiled binaries. url: https://github.com/ablab/spades/releases/download/v{{ version }}/SPAdes-{{ version }}-Darwin.tar.gz # [osx] - sha256: e2a4f589c190767310545300386c7e2841ebdfe3775850cd52879ef01d376575 # [osx] + sha256: 86dac86962b6d26891eb9b1d173d8dd5ce957482013880f6d75b751b7bb274a0 # [osx] url: https://github.com/ablab/spades/releases/download/v{{ version }}/SPAdes-{{ version }}-Linux.tar.gz # [linux] - sha256: 5e8988b0cfd8b5a84b718e1e5af21524c7b1369bcba337dfebeed9c22a4f7141 # [linux] + sha256: 3666b256e2239adbdf9d8b3e3e6a60b2d8d51878b892ea6a821b033a5ef0d03b # [linux] build: - number: 1 + number: 0 requirements: run: @@ -24,7 +24,6 @@ test: - spades.py --version - rnaspades.py --version - truspades.py --version - - dipspades.py --version - metaspades.py --version - plasmidspades.py --version - spades.py --test && rm -rf spades_test